# Divestiture of the Brightwell Fixtures Unit (Managers Only)

Finance team: as you've probably guessed from the data-room requests, Corvane Holdings is moving ahead with selling the Brightwell Fixtures unit. Two bidders remain after the Kestrow round. Carve-out accounting starts next month — expect extra allocation work on shared overheads. Keep all queries routed through the deal desk, not the unit itself. The confidential deal context is noted below.

internal memo for taguf-kafop: Novmirax Group plans to lower the Oliius list price by 42.0 percent in March. The board signed off on a budget of $367.8 million for Project Belael. The renewal with Drumirax Logistics closes at $302.4 million a year, 54.0 percent below the last contract. Project Kelys slips by a full year because of the staffing delay.

## Onboarding — Markdown Pipeline (Inkmere)

Inkmere docs render through a three-stage pipeline: parse, sanitize, emit. Releases rebuild all templates; never hot-patch emitted HTML. Broken renders usually mean a sanitizer rule change — check the rules diff first. The render cluster only accepts builds from the release channel, and every build artifact must be signed before upload. Sign artifacts with the deploy key below.

release key, hafop-tajef: bky13_s2vaFVNJTHfBL

**Action item: Splitwick assignment jitter**

Quick recap for plugin folks: during the Brindle rollout, our A/B assignment service (Splitwick) re-bucketed a chunk of users mid-experiment because the hash seed rotated early. If your plugin caches variant IDs, that's on us, not you — but please start honoring the `assignment_ttl` hint going forward.

We've pinned the seed rotation to the release train and tightened retry behavior so assignments stay sticky across restarts. The defaults below are what Splitwick will ship with next cycle.

tuning table, kajog-kawef:
PRIORITIES = {
    "kelox": 870,
    "kasix": 89,
    "eliax": 988,
}

Handover note — Crumbwheel order cutoffs.

Welcome aboard. The bakery cutoff rule in Crumbwheel closes same-day orders at 14:00 local to each storefront, not UTC — this has bitten us twice. Holiday overrides live in the calendar service and take precedence silently, so always check there first when a cutoff looks wrong. To unlock the calendar service's admin console after a restart, enter the recovery passphrase below.

vault phrase of bagap-bahaf = silion-pelox-sorox-casdor-quenwyn-fraax-eliox-praael-kelion-quenvan-kasox-rusael-norius-belvan